-Подписка по e-mail

 

 -Поиск по дневнику

Поиск сообщений в web_development

 -Статистика

Статистика LiveInternet.ru: показано количество хитов и посетителей
Создан: 09.03.2005
Записей:
Комментариев:
Написано: 418


Поиск по сайту

Пятница, 14 Октября 2005 г. 16:36 + в цитатник
holy_diver все записи автора Кому-нибудь приходилось делать? Делать ручками, честно говоря, лень, хотя есть две идеи, как это сделать.
Знает ли кто-нибудь готовые (или хотя бы полуготовые) бесплатные решения, которые можно было бы обработать напильником? Заказчик жмот. mnogosearch не подходит, возможности компилить что-то нет.
Пока прицепил risearch-php с rumor (модуль русской морфологии), но уж очень геморройно его идексатор напильником обрабатывать:
1. идексировать можно либо содержимое файлов (а сайт целиком динамический), либо по http (но тогда он жрёт много трафика, а заказчик, как я уже говорил, - жмот).
Можно, конечно, с помощью лома и такой-то матери заставить его индексировать данные из базы так, как мне нужно, но мне проще написать свой поисковик с тем же румором (а я уже говорил, что велосипедотворчеством заниматься не хочу). И к тому же
2. идексируется каждый раз всё целиком. А там уже около сотни метров, хотя проект пока не запущен. Заставить его добавлять к индексу только новые файлы я пока не смог. Опять же, проще сделать самому.

shakirov   обратиться по имени Пятница, 14 Октября 2005 г. 16:38 (ссылка)
может воспользоваться google-вым поиском на сайте?
Ответить С цитатой В цитатник
holy_diver   обратиться по имени Re: Ответ в web_development; Поиск по сайту Пятница, 14 Октября 2005 г. 16:43 (ссылка)
1000 запросов в сутки будет мало.
В колонках играет: Weather Report - Umbrellas

LI 5.09.15
Ответить С цитатой В цитатник
Танцы_с_Волками   обратиться по имени Пятница, 14 Октября 2005 г. 20:53 (ссылка)
Сейчас у меня тоже возникла проблема поиска, но пока она не стоит так остро. Есть ключевые слова для сайта, они хранятся в базе. Есть форма, в нее вбиваются слова и они ищутся в базе.В общем все стандартно. Сейчас пользуюсь таким запросом SQL "SELECT * FROM words WHERE word LIKE '%word%'" Но думаю, что в будущем этого будет не достаточно. Может подскажите какую-нибудь технологию поиска учитывающую там всякие морфы и т.д. Или ссылки на статьи полезные
Ответить С цитатой В цитатник
holy_diver   обратиться по имени Re: Ответ в web_development; Поиск по сайту Пятница, 14 Октября 2005 г. 22:15 (ссылка)
Для морфологии можно использовать модуль rumor (http://risearch.org/rus/rumor/index.html), он бесплатен. Неплохая статья про поиск была в седьмом номере phpinside (http://phpiside.ru).
Если сайт небольшой и не очень часто обновляется, но рекомендую riSearch-php, опять же бесплатный, и с очень свободной лицензией - модифициорвать можно как угодно, запрещено только распространять модифицированные.
В колонках играет: Weather Report - Umbrellas

LI 5.09.15
Ответить С цитатой В цитатник
Комментировать К дневнику Страницы: [1] [Новые]
 

Добавить комментарий:
Текст комментария: смайлики

Проверка орфографии: (найти ошибки)

Прикрепить картинку:

 Переводить URL в ссылку
 Подписаться на комментарии
 Подписать картинку